Can assertion be proven?

Assertions. When we make statements, they are primarily either assertions or assessments. Assertions can be proven to be true or false. Assessments are not absolutely true or false, but are a contextual or relative statement—or an opinion.

Is an assertion a fact?

assertion Add to list Share. An assertion is a declaration that’s made emphatically, especially as part of an argument or as if it’s to be understood as a statement of fact. To assert is to state with force. So if someone makes an assertion, they’re not just trying out an idea — they really mean it.

What type of claim asserts an empirical truth?

Types of Claims Fact: A claim asserts some empirical truth. Something that can be determined by careful observation of past, present, or future.

How are expression formed?

Algebraic expression is formed from variables and constants using different operations. Expressions are made up of terms. A term is the product of factors. Sometimes, any factor in a term is called the coefficient of the remaining part of the term.

What is an opinion statement in an essay?

An opinion essay is a formal piece of writing which requires your opinion on a topic. Your opinion should be stated clearly. Throughout the essay you will give various arguments/reasons/viewpoints on the topic and these will be supported by evidence and/or examples.
